(Asiad) S. Korea beat Philippines to qualify for women’s football quarterfinals
South Korea defeated the Philippines 5-1 to grab a ticket to the quarterfinals in women’s football at the Asian Games in China on Monday. Son Hwa-yeon scored a hat trick, with Ji So-yun and Chun Garam chipping in a goal apiece for South Korea in Group E action at Wenzhou Sports Centre
S. Korea to allow registered foreign institutions to participate in FX market
SEOUL, Sept. 25 (Xinhua) — South Korea’s finance ministry said on Monday that the country will allow registered foreign institutions (RFIs) to participate in the foreign exchange market next month.
